Building Confidence
When you learn to drive, you have to gain confidence in your own ability. This is a huge step to be patient to ensure you don't overextend yourself. A good driving teacher will understand this and not take you too far. It is crucial to have a well-planned series of lessons. This is vital for anyone who wants to be successful in passing their test. Having a clear plan of what you'd like to achieve during each lesson will keep you engaged and confident about your progress.
It is also important to keep in mind that your previous experiences of failure and success affect your perception of driving. If you have a history of poor driving experiences the confidence you have in your Tony Mac Driving Courses abilities will decline. In the same way, if you've had a lot of success, this will increase your confidence. Try to make an effort to concentrate on the positive aspects of your driving and remind yourself of the accomplishments you have made, no matter how small.
One of the best ways to increase your confidence is to take driving lessons in Edinburgh. You will be able to test different roads, speeds, and weather conditions. You will also be able to practice different maneuvers and discover how to handle tricky areas like narrow streets and steep hills. This will help you prepare for driving on roads that are real after you pass your test.
You can also utilize a variety of methods to manage anxiety and stress when taking driving lessons. You can utilize breathing exercises, relaxation audios and self-talk. It is also recommended to make an effort to get a good night's sleep before your driving lessons and that you don't drink alcohol or smoke before driving. This will prevent you from getting stressed out or experiencing panic attacks while you are driving.
You can also build your confidence by driving in the most challenging situations, such as busy roads or parking lots that are multi-storey. You'll be able to demonstrate to yourself that these conditions are not an issue. By practicing these challenging driving scenarios during the quietest hours of the day can assist you in conquering your fears and help you become an experienced driver.

Training in a Variety of Areas
It's important that you spend time practicing in various areas if you're learning how to drive in Edinburgh. From the narrow streets of the Old Town to the busy streets of the city centre It's essential to gain experience driving on a wide range of roads and traffic conditions prior to taking your test.
A good instructor will know where the best place is to practice and will make sure you're comfortable with the road and traffic conditions before the day of your test. Practising at different locations will also help you build confidence and familiarity of the city's layout. This is important when it comes to preparing for your driving test and life as a motorist.
The best place to start your driving lessons in Edinburgh is in close proximity to a school. For instance, Marine Drive in Davidson's Mains, or the Royal High School in East Barnton Avenue. These are more peaceful locations and are a great place to start off your driving lessons, before moving on to busier roads such as Queensferry Road or Lothian Road when you're more confident. Busy roads are also ideal for practicing your planning and anticipation, as well as safe and defensive Driving Lessons Scunthorpe techniques.
Other areas that are worth your time include Comely Bank and Craigleith, Murrayfield and Roseburn, and Morningside. These locations are typically less crowded than Haymarket and are a good location to practice parking and maneuvering. Some of these locations are also ideal for practicing lane changing and cornering.
You could also spend time in areas where the speed limits are lower. Many of these roads are governed by a 20mph limit and are a great way to practice before you take on more difficult routes, such as dual-carriageways and motorways.
